Natural disasters. System disruptions. Outages, emergencies, and failures. Faced with these situations, the goal is to continue “normal” operations while working to fix the problem as fast as possible. Co-workers, partners, and other key personnel must be able to connect, collaborate, and take action, even if they’ve been evacuated or displaced. And customer needs must be handled with a “business-as-usual” effectiveness.

But in today’s highly distributed business environment, the solution you put in place to ensure the continuity of your business communications must also work with your existing assets, be stable and redundant, and work in heterogeneous environments.
